git squash

相關問題 & 資訊整理

git squash

我們來試試合併「添加commit的說明」和「添加pull的說明」的提交,成為一個提交吧! 目前的歷史記錄. 若要合併過去的提交,請使用rebase -i命令。 $ git rebase -i HEAD ... ,本地端的歷史記錄狀態會如下圖顯示。我們來修改「添加commit的說明」的提交內容吧。 目前的歷史記錄. 使用rebase -i 命令選擇要修改的提交 $ git rebase -i HEAD~~. ,請參考下圖: $ git checkout master Switched to branch 'master' $ git merge --squash issue1 Auto-merging sample.txt CONFLICT (content): Merge conflict in ... ,切换到master分支后,指定--squash选项执行merge。 $ git checkout master Switched to branch 'master' $ git merge --squash issue1 Auto-merging sample.txt ... , 在团队合作中,毫无疑问,我们需要一个版本管理工具,相对于SVN 这种在我们看来是老古董的工具,Git 在年轻化的团队中更受欢迎。并不仅仅是 ..., 用於合併不同分支時,希望在合併後只有一個提交記錄。 $ git merge —-squash <branch_name>. 範例. 開發新功能的時候,往往會另 ...,squash. 同樣的,在另一次的Squash 也會再編輯一次Commit 訊息,我把它改成「add all dogs」。整個Rebase 的訊息如下:. $ git rebase -i bb0c9c2 [detached HEAD ... , 這樣…不是會跑出一堆亂七八槽的commit嗎? 這就要用到git squash功能了比如說現在我隨便commit一些版本,log顯示為:. commit ..., git rebase -i 49687a0a646954afdf3f4dae1f914ea793341ea2. 按下enter後會進到編輯模式. Step2:squash. 一開始編輯視窗的內容是這樣 ..., git bisect. 它是一種幫助你快速找到壞掉的commit 的工具,原理是用Binary Search 演算法的核心概念,每次的 ...

相關軟體 SourceTree 資訊

SourceTree
SourceTree 是與 Git 和 Mercurial 一起工作的快捷方式。從一個應用程序輕鬆使用分佈式版本控制系統。在不離開應用程序的情況下使用您的 GitHub,Bitbucket 和 Kiln 帳戶。也適用於 Subversion 服務器! Atlassian 已經收購了 SourceTree,現在在有限的時間內免費! Full-powered DVCS告別命令行&ndash; 在 So... SourceTree 軟體介紹

git squash 相關參考資料
5. 使用rebase -i 合併提交【教學3 改寫提交】 | 連猴子都能懂的Git ...

我們來試試合併「添加commit的說明」和「添加pull的說明」的提交,成為一個提交吧! 目前的歷史記錄. 若要合併過去的提交,請使用rebase -i命令。 $ git rebase -i HEAD&nbsp;...

https://backlog.com

6. 使用rebase -i 修改提交【教學3 改寫提交】 | 連猴子都能懂的Git ...

本地端的歷史記錄狀態會如下圖顯示。我們來修改「添加commit的說明」的提交內容吧。 目前的歷史記錄. 使用rebase -i 命令選擇要修改的提交 $ git rebase -i HEAD~~.

https://backlog.com

7. Merge --squash【教學3 改寫提交】 | 連猴子都能懂的Git入門 ...

請參考下圖: $ git checkout master Switched to branch &#39;master&#39; $ git merge --squash issue1 Auto-merging sample.txt CONFLICT (content): Merge conflict in&nbsp;...

https://backlog.com

7. merge --squash【教程3 改写提交!】| 猴子都能懂的GIT入门 ...

切换到master分支后,指定--squash选项执行merge。 $ git checkout master Switched to branch &#39;master&#39; $ git merge --squash issue1 Auto-merging sample.txt&nbsp;...

https://backlog.com

git merge squash 和rebase 区别- 简书

在团队合作中,毫无疑问,我们需要一个版本管理工具,相对于SVN 这种在我们看来是老古董的工具,Git 在年轻化的团队中更受欢迎。并不仅仅是&nbsp;...

https://www.jianshu.com

Git: 比較Merge Squash 與Rebase Squash | Summer。桑莫。夏天

用於合併不同分支時,希望在合併後只有一個提交記錄。 $ git merge —-squash &lt;branch_name&gt;. 範例. 開發新功能的時候,往往會另&nbsp;...

https://cythilya.github.io

【狀況題】把多個Commit 合併成一個Commit - 為你自己學Git ...

squash. 同樣的,在另一次的Squash 也會再編輯一次Commit 訊息,我把它改成「add all dogs」。整個Rebase 的訊息如下:. $ git rebase -i bb0c9c2 [detached HEAD&nbsp;...

https://gitbook.tw

使用git squash 合併commit - Yoda生活筆記

這樣…不是會跑出一堆亂七八槽的commit嗎? 這就要用到git squash功能了比如說現在我隨便commit一些版本,log顯示為:. commit&nbsp;...

https://yodalee.blogspot.com

如何合併多個commits - 李嘉玲的技術筆記

git rebase -i 49687a0a646954afdf3f4dae1f914ea793341ea2. 按下enter後會進到編輯模式. Step2:squash. 一開始編輯視窗的內容是這樣&nbsp;...

http://zerodie.github.io

為什麼我不用Squash and merge. 今年二月剛進公司沒多久我試 ...

git bisect. 它是一種幫助你快速找到壞掉的commit 的工具,原理是用Binary Search 演算法的核心概念,每次的&nbsp;...

https://medium.com